Carrollton is located in Michigan. Carrollton, Michigan 48724has a population of 5,753. Carrollton 48724 is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 8.9%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 24.49%.
The median household income in Carrollton, Michigan 48724 is $37,828. The median household income for the surrounding county is $52,749 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in Carrollton 48724 is 36.4 years.
The average high temperature in July is 82.2 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 15.1 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 32.4 inches per year, with 41.4 inches of snow per year.
